Underground Prison Museum

The underground prison was a prison in the heart of Jerusalem run by the British mandatory Force. In addition to regular criminals, the prison held many Jews who were involved in the underground movements that were fighting for Jewish Independence in the years prior to 1948. This museum tells their story.

The Bomb shelter of a Aner Shapira

Aner Elyakim Shapira was born on March 12, 2001 and died a hero on October 7, 2023. While taking cover in a shelter, Shapira threw back at Hamas militants 7 explosive grenades they had originally thrown into the shelter. Ultimately, he saved the lives of at least 7 people who survived the massacre.
